The "Big Game" of Trademark Infringements?

With Super Bowl XLV a few short days away, and less than 30 miles from my office, trademark and copyright infringement of the Super Bowl trademark, and the teams' trademarks and copyrights are top on my mind. If the "Clean Zones" I blogged about here do not slow down the infringers, the the weather here in North Texas will discourage many infring-e-preneurs from setting up shop.

The Fort Worth Star Telegram alludes to the NFL having already secured John Doe Temporary Restraining Orders to enforce the NFL's rights in the registered trademarks of Super Bowl and NFL.  The teams each own their individual trademarks in the team names and logos.
